Before anything else I gotta tell you, having a phone like this with pre paid service is not a very smart Idea but anyways that's beside the point, ummm, lets see, I personally don't have Amazon or Time lite or lever or counter or blackboard or compass or Windows live messenger, I don't see how those have anything to do with data usage, I'd say delete the AP news and Bloomberg, I don't see how you need them right now, just to see if that helps your situation. What do you use for email? And one more thing, go on and do this for me:
Menu->settings->connectivity->admin setting->packet data->packet data connection change that to when needed and also change the access point to none
and also go to 
Menu->settings->connectivity->destinations-> internet->and go under which ever packet data you use and change the setting  for use access point to after confirmation, mines on automatic since I have a data plan. Try those two and then also tell me what email you use we should figure this problem out. But the I say if you get rid of Bloomberg and AP news and accuweather and try the stuff I said we I'd say your problem should be solved. You can always install them back one by one and if the problem comes back then you know what program causes it.

    beecart wrote:
    nick <<<SMS sends/receives data over the cell phone network - it doesn't access the internet. The reason it tries to access the network when you start it is to check for any SMS messages you have and also, I suppose, to establish and validate a connection so that you can send or receive when you need to.>>>
    so does the above mean that if someone sends an sms it doesn't come through until you click on the message icon to check for them? i am having problems with delayed sms/mms but find that the backlog all come through sometimes when i have 'woke' the iphone, click on message app or launched an app.
    Any thoughts ?
    No - what ought to happen is that the SMS message is pushed straight to your phone. If you're in an area of weak service, the SMS messages might not be able to get through straight away and, when that happens, it can sometimes take a long while after you move to an area of good signal for the messages to arrive. I recently spent some months working in a building where my carrier (O2 in the UK) had very poor to non-existent reception. People would SMS me during the day and, even though I came out of the building frequently, I often didn't get the messages on my phone until late evening.
    Hope that helps

  • Why does a standalone program created in Labview 8.5 try connecting to the internet when the program only reads data through the serial port? Firewalls object to progams that contact the internet without permission.

    why does a standalone program created in Labview 8.5 try connecting to the internet when the program only reads data through the serial port? Firewalls object to progams that contact the internet without permission.
    The created program is not performing a command I have written when it tries to connect to the internet, it must be Labview that is doing it. How do I stop this from happening? 
    Any help would be very appreciated.

    It looks that way..
    "When LabVIEW starts it contacts the service
    locator to removes all services for itself. This request is triggering
    the firewall.This is done in case there were services that were not
    unregistered the last time LabVIEW executed- for example from VIs that
    didn't clean up after themselves"
    This is not yet fixed in LV2009.
